Step 2: Assess the Venue Environment

Before deploying your 2.4 GHz wireless microphone, evaluate the venue to identify potential sources of interference, such as Wi-Fi routers, mobile devices, and other wireless systems. This assessment is crucial to ensure a clear signal during live events.

This assessment might involve using a spectrum analyzer to map out frequency usage in the venue, which aids in selecting the best operating frequencies for your microphone.

Step 4: Prepare for Real-Time Adjustments

During the event, be prepared to make real-time adjustments as necessary. A 2.4 GHz wireless microphone can experience fluctuations, so having a skilled technician on hand to monitor audio levels and signal strength can greatly enhance the experience.

If an audible distortion is detected, quickly adjust your audio settings or reposition the microphone to optimize sound clarity.
